There are such a large variety of Verizon cell phones that it is important to understand the differences before purchasing. If choosing a Verizon cell phone such as a Blackberry or Droid, there is a requirement to have expensive data package plan. Other phones have data capability as well, but they do not require the data package in order to use the phone. The needs of the account holder must be taken into consideration before deciding on which type of Verizon cell phone to purchase.
